What they do
An Athletic Trainer treats injuries and provides training to minimize the risk of injury for athletes and people playing sports. Responds when an athlete is injured on the field. Works for schools or colleges, for professional sports teams, or in physicians' offices.

Job Description
This tenure-track faculty position is a member of the Department of Athletics Faculty that report directly to the President. This is a Full-Time 10-month faculty appointment providing strong leadership, care, and service to our 22 NCAA division II varsity sports programs. Salary is very competitive, at an Instructor I to Assistant I level, and includes an attractive benefit package. Prior to a final offer of employment, the selected candidate will be required to submit to a background check including, but not limited to, employment verification, educational and other credential verification, PA Child Abuse History Clearance, FBI Fingerprint Clearance and PA Criminal Background. Finalists for the position must communicate well and successfully complete an on-campus interview process. Anticipated start date is August 1, 2026.
